Microsoft Photosynth

What is Photosynth:

Photosynth03 Photosynth automatically stitches together your digital photographs to create a three-dimensional image.
It’s sort of like a still movie, perhaps. It’s just one object or location captured, but rather than being limited to capturing it in one photograph, you can take many photographs and capture the whole thing in detailed photos, and then they’re stitched together by Photosynth and you are then able to experience your photos in a very creative and fascinating way. You are able to move around, as if you were turning your head to see more of what’s around you, and zoom in as if you were moving closer towards something. It’s difficult to explain, so I would highly recommend you view some Synths created by others already. I have included some incredible Synths in this article below.

A wonderful thing about Photosynth is that you can download and install it for free. All you need is your Windows Live ID and you’re good to go.
